I sure can relate to the urge!

I even found myself wishing it were a few more miles to and from work. Driving the Z is a real adrenaline rush! And I make up excuses to go drive somewhere on an "errand." When 4:00 p.m. rolls around at work, my mind starts to wander to thoughts of being able to slip behind the wheel and turn a few RPMs. Love the sound of the engine growl above 4,000 -- the Z is pure animal!

Yesterday, some young fool in a Sebring (obviously an automatic)thought he was hot stuff -- idiot was barely off the light spinning his wheels when I hit 60 and backed off. I didn't anticipate giving him a demo of power, but when I heard his tires squeal, I just mashed the gas to the floor and power shifted to second a little above 6K -- and I even had the VDC on...

Little dude shouldn't try to mess with this 54 year-old granny! In my younger days, I used to drag my '65 GTO -- bored & stroked triple deuce with a cam, Hurst close-ratio turning a 473 drag r&p (ran a 308 r&p on the street). Anyone old enough to remember "Little GTO"?
